Meaning and Definition

A blue, crystalline chemical compound with the formula Cu(OH)₂, used primarily as a fungicide, pigment, and in various chemical processes.

In industrial and educational contexts, it can also refer to the substance in various states (e.g., freshly precipitated gel, dry powder) used in catalysis, as a precursor to other copper compounds, and in school chemistry experiments.

Yes, it can be harmful if ingested or inhaled, and it is toxic to aquatic life. Safety data sheets (SDS) should always be consulted.

It is typically a light blue or blue-green solid.

It is very rare in nature. The mineral form is called spertiniite, but it is not common. It is usually manufactured synthetically.

Copper hydroxide (Cu(OH)₂) contains hydroxide ions (OH⁻), while copper oxide (CuO) contains oxide ions (O²⁻). They have different chemical formulas, properties, and uses.
